Definition, synonyms and picture of heal


verbo heal

Translation: cicatrizar

Definition of heal in Spanish

Of a wound, to get better until it is closed and repaired.

Synonyms of heal in Spanish


Definition of heal in English

Curarse una herida hasta quedar cerrada y reparada.

Synonyms of heal in English